Think Globally, Drink Locally
My friend Eric Zimmerman said it best “think globally, drink locally”… it was on the back of a T-Shirt that he handed out at his fund raising golf event. We donate and attend the event every year. We know just about every one there… it is truly a great day. I know he meant “think globally”, things like “be green”, conserve energy, do right by your global neighbor… you know, things like that. But I know Eric… he didn’t just mean “drink” locally however; I think he had a bigger message in mind. Eric, who is one of the biggest supporters of local business, passes along a great message here. Support your local business. Local people who run local service and retail outlets in your town are the foundation of your community. They employ local people, pay their taxes to local government… for your benefit… to keep your roads plowed and paved, turning on the street lights, providing parks and recreation areas for your enjoyment, things you may take for granted. From the local business owners I have spoken to, they support local business themselves… you know they “drink locally”! (Sometimes literally) Local economies depend on the success of locally owned business… period! In your town there are many locally owned business: the HVAC guy who has a shop and maybe works alone or has a few employees he pays each week and helps with their health insurance, the locally owned gas station or automotive service center that has an owner who lives in your town and employs folks who may be your neighbor or just any local service or retail business… remember they are the folks who depend on your support, they provide fast, reliable and reasonable service, stand behind their work and products, live in your town and may be spending money in your local business.
